The Fire Focus beam is pretty close to the concept you described. The defs where pretty cautious with fire starter weapons, as fires can be pretty powerfull and I try to stay true to that. The Fire Focus already is pretty powerfull in that regard.

+1 fire chance equals an additional 10% fire chance. Weapons that had no fire chance before will gain it through the prefix. On beams that chance is rolled for every room tile the beam hits.

I liked that concept, but defining it as a cryo thing would have been a little weird, as there would have been no way to prevent some strange situations from happening (like freezing a room that is completely on fire :shock: ). But CE already has the "heavy Lockdown" effect, which is basically the cryo effect that was described (crew stunned, aka frozen/crystallized, room blocked). The Crystal Lockdown Bomb Mark II and the Crystal Lockdown Blast Mark II cause this effect.
